About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Ltd
- The Promoter, Mr. Devendra Singh Yadav started its operations of Diagnostic Centre in the name and style of 'Modern X-Ray and Clinical Lab' as Proprietorship firm in year 1985, which was later designated as '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re' in 1992.
-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Limited was erstwhile incorporated as '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Private Limited' as a private company, vide Certificate of Incorporation dated April 16, 2012 issued by Registrar of Companies, Delhi . Thereafter, the Company acquired the business of M/s.
- Modern Diagnostics & Research Centre, a Proprietorship Concern through Business Transfer Agreement in 2013.
- Subsequently, its status got converted from private limited into public limited and the name of the Company was changed to '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Limited' pursuant to fresh certificate of incorporation dated December 18, 2024 issued by Registrar of Companies, Central Processing Centre.

How do stock splits affect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Ltd's share price history?
Stock splits reduce the nominal price of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Ltd's shares by increasing the number of outstanding shares, which typically makes the stock more accessible to a broader range of investors. Although the total market value of the company remains unchanged after the split, the split can affect investor perception and liquidity, potentially influencing the share price in the longer term.
How do dividends impact the share price history of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Ltd?
Dividends can influence Modern Diagnostic & Research Centre Ltd's share price history by typically causing a temporary dip on the ex-dividend date, as the stock price often adjusts to reflect the dividend payout. Over time, the impact of dividends on the share price may be offset by the company's overall financial performance and market conditions.
